Gainful Employment Programs

The U.S. Department of Education requires institutions to disclose to prospective students particular information regarding their educational programs that lead to gainful employment in a recognized occupation. While all of Hawkeye’s programs are designed to lead to either employment and/or college transfer, federal regulations require the disclosure of information for certificates and diploma programs. The Department of Education published a final rule on July 1, 2019, rescinding the Department’s gainful employment (GE) regulations (2014 Rule), effective July 1, 2020. The final rule also allowed institutions to implement the rescission early. Hawkeye Community College opted for early implementation effective July 1, 2019.

We continue to believe that students have the right to information about all programs’ costs, course sequence, certification requirements, transfer and career opportunities, potential employment and future wages related to their program of study, among other things; which may be found on specific programs web pages. In addition, every student works with an advisor to create an appropriate degree audit plan to ensure students complete a degree, diploma, or certificate in a timely and effective manner. Budget planning, responsible borrowing, and career research are also highly encouraged along the way.
